Steep and winding roads

Beautiful. We stayed in campground 28, edge of the mountain, hard to beat those views, but the inclement weather cut our trip short. It was very windy, I didn’t sleep much worried that the tent would collapse. Our canopy’s front half flew out of the ground in the middle of the first night, (yes it was staked down but without guy-lines, I wasn’t anticipating hurricane force winds). The road to the campground is very steep, very winding, super sharp curves, which was fun for a car, but I don’t know how people get big rigs up those roads. Campground was well tended to, clean bathrooms and friendly hosts. Definitely wanna go back and enjoy it properly.
